Provides access to members that controls calculation of unique values.
Members
| Name | Description | |
|---|---|---|
![]()  | 
AddFromBlock | Adds decimal values truncated to a given precision from a given a pixel block. | 
![]()  | 
AddFromRaster | Adds values from a given band of a Raster. | 
![]()  | 
AddFromRasterAsDecimal | Adds decimal values truncated to a given precision from a given band of a Raster. | 
![]()  | 
AddFromTable | Adds values of a field of a table. | 
![]()  | 
BlockSize | The calculation block size. | 
![]()  | 
MaxUniqueValueCount | The maximum number of unique values. | 
IRasterCalcUniqueValues3.AddFromBlock Method
Adds decimal values truncated to a given precision from a given a pixel block.
Public Sub AddFromBlock ( _
    ByVal pBlock As IPixelBlock, _
    ByVal precision As Double, _
    ByVal pUniqueValues As IUniqueValues _
)
public void AddFromBlock (
    IPixelBlock pBlock,
    double precision,
    IUniqueValues pUniqueValues
);
IRasterCalcUniqueValues3.BlockSize Property
The calculation block size.
Public Property BlockSize As IPnt
public IPnt BlockSize {get; set;}
Inherited Interfaces
| Interfaces | Description | 
|---|---|
| IRasterCalcUniqueValues2 | Provides access to members that controls calculation of unique values. | 
| IRasterCalcUniqueValues | Provides access to members that controls calculation of unique values. | 
Classes that implement IRasterCalcUniqueValues3
| Classes | Description | 
|---|---|
| RasterCalcUniqueValues | A helper class for calculating raster unique values. | 

